New Construction Plumbing in Denver, CO
New construction plumbing services involve installing and setting up the plumbing systems in newly built homes, commercial buildings, or additions. This includes laying out water supply lines, installing drains and waste systems, and ensuring proper connections for fixtures such as sinks, toilets, and appliances. Property owners planning a new build or major renovation typically want to understand the scope of work involved, the materials used, and how the plumbing system will integrate with other building systems to ensure reliable performance and compliance with local codes.
Before requesting new construction plumbing services, property owners should consider factors such as the complexity of the project, the layout of the building, and any specific plumbing needs or preferences. It’s important to communicate details about the building plans, including the number of fixtures, water sources, and drainage requirements. Understanding these aspects helps ensure that the plumbing installation is tailored to the property’s design and future use, providing a functional and efficient system from the start.

Common New Construction Plumbing Jobs
New Home Plumbing Installations - comprehensive plumbing systems designed for new construction projects.
Water Supply Line Setup - installation of water lines to ensure reliable water delivery throughout the property.
Drain and Waste Systems - placement of drain pipes and waste lines to support efficient plumbing function.
Fixture and Appliance Rough-Ins - preparing plumbing connections for sinks, toilets, and appliances during framing.
Main Sewer Line Connections - establishing secure connections to the municipal sewer system for proper waste removal.
Water Heater and Fixture Hookups - installing and connecting water heaters and plumbing fixtures for immediate use.
New Construction Plumbing Questions
What types of new construction plumbing services are available? Services include installing plumbing systems for new homes, commercial buildings, and renovations, ensuring proper water supply and drainage from the start.
When should plumbing be installed during construction? Plumbing is typically installed during the framing stage before walls are finished, to allow for proper placement and access.
What plumbing materials are used in new construction projects? Common materials include copper, PEX, and PVC pipes, chosen for durability and suitability to the project’s needs.
Why is professional plumbing installation important in new construction? Proper installation ensures reliable water flow, prevents leaks, and meets building codes for safety and efficiency.
